All students will start each day with their clip on the “Ready to Learn” section of the behavior chart. As Mrs. Yashinski notices students behaving respectfully & responsibly, she will move their clip up to the “Amazing” section. If quality behavior continues, students will be moved to the “Excellent Role Model” section of the chart. If a student is making choices that are disruptive to themselves and/or classmates, they will be moved down to the “Reminder” section of the chart. Finally, if a student continues to make disruptive choices, they will be Mrs. Yashinski will email or call the parent to discuss the behavior and steps taken to redirect and support the student.
At the end of each day, if your clip is on:
Excellent Role Model you will earn +3 points
Amazing you will earn +2 points
Ready To Learn you will earn +1 point
“Reminder” you will earn 0 points
Students will keep track of their minutes on a monthly calendar found in their agenda. Minutes will be added at the end of each week. On Friday afternoons, they will enjoy that number minutes for Preferred Activity Time (PAT)!
